StudyCoach AI - Flutter AI Learning AssistantStudyCoach AI - Flutter AI Learning Assistant
Launch an AI-powered study app in minutes. Includes AI Tutor (Gemini/OpenAI), JSON content system, and AdMob monetization.StudyCoach AI - Flutter AI Learning Assistant
Launch an AI-powered study app in minutes. Includes AI Tutor (Gemini/OpenAI), JSON content system...
Overview
StudyCoach AI is a premium Flutter template designed to build modern AI-powered learning and education apps.
Transform traditional quizzes and study sets into an intelligent learning experience where an AI Tutor analyzes the user's answers and provides personalized explanations.
Instead of showing only scores, StudyCoach AI helps users understand why answers are correct or incorrect, making it ideal for educational apps, learning platforms, and exam preparation tools.
With a powerful JSON-driven content engine, developers can manage questions, explanations, and study sets without modifying the Flutter code.
StudyCoach AI is designed for scalability, performance, and monetization, making it a perfect starting point for launching professional learning apps.
Key Highlights
AI Tutor System
Provide intelligent explanations and learning feedback using Google Gemini or OpenAI.
Premium Emerald & Slate UI
Clean, modern design optimized for focus and readability.
JSON Content Engine
Manage questions, answers, and explanations without touching the Flutter code.
Monetization Ready
Integrated AdMob rewarded ads and coin-based reward system.
Features
AI-Powered Tutor System
Real-time AI explanations based on user answers and performance.
Dual AI Provider Support
Switch between Google Gemini and OpenAI with a single configuration.
Dynamic JSON Content Engine
Easily add or modify study content without rebuilding the app.
Premium UI/UX
High-performance Emerald & Slate theme designed for education apps.
Multi-Language Ready
Supports English, Japanese, Spanish, and easy localization.
Monetization System
Built-in AdMob integration with rewarded ads and coin economy.
Clean Flutter Architecture
Structured GetX architecture with scalable modular design.
Requirements
Flutter SDK 3.16+
Dart SDK 3.0+
Android Studio or VS Code
Google AdMob Account (for ads)
Gemini API Key or OpenAI API Key
Instructions
- Extract the downloaded ZIP file.
- Open the project in Android Studio or VS Code.
- Run the following command:
flutter pub get
-
Open
lib/core/constants.dartand configure:
- AI API Keys
- AdMob App IDs
- Modify study content in:
assets/data/tests.json
- Run the app:
flutter run
- Build production release:
flutter build apk flutter build ios
Full documentation is included in the documentation/index.html file.
Other items by this author
|
Flutter App Reskin Service
Have your App reskinned to meet your needs.
|
$499 | Buy now |
| Category | App Templates / Flutter / Full Applications |
| First release | 12 March 2026 |
| Last update | 12 March 2026 |
| Operating Systems | Android 8.0, iOS 11.0, Android 9.0, iOS 12.0, Android 10.0, iOS 14.0, iOS 13.0, iOS 15.0, Android 11.0 |
| Files included | .css, .html, .java, .xml, Javascript .js |








